Output 89ca2b28fed4079ffc3f17fb25e87b194c74cfc3ec67a582c0181678e2a67d9a:1

value
2585648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f8653831ad3bfcb9933a67f971e485a224b69b OP_EQUAL
address
33sm2mcdLfTtHwybLrysBThxuDdbfcQwG2
transaction
89ca2b28fed4079ffc3f17fb25e87b194c74cfc3ec67a582c0181678e2a67d9a
spent
true